Comprehending Medicare: An Introduction
Medicare functions as a vital safeguard for elderly people, giving basic health and wellness coverage as they age. Established in 1965, this federal program aims to help people aged 65 and older, along with some younger people with impairments. By supplying a range of strategies, Medicare resolves the distinct healthcare demands of its beneficiaries. The program's framework consists of various elements, each designed to satisfy details health coverage requirements.Understanding Medicare is vital for elders, as it allows them to make informed decisions concerning their healthcare choices. Registration usually begins 3 months prior to people transform 65, allowing ample time to check out the offered strategies. Furthermore, expertise of qualification criteria, insurance coverage specifics, and prospective expenses can meaningfully affect a senior's overall wellness and economic well-being. Eventually, Medicare plays an indispensable role in guaranteeing that seniors receive the treatment they need during their gold years.
Medicare Parts A and B: What They Cover

Hospital Insurance Policy Advantages
Health center insurance coverage benefits play a necessary role in supplying financial backing for seniors throughout healthcare. Medicare Part A mostly covers inpatient healthcare facility keeps, knowledgeable nursing facility care, hospice care, and some home wellness solutions. This part guarantees that senior citizens get needed therapy without frustrating financial concerns. On The Other Hand, Medicare Component B encompasses outpatient care, preventive solutions, and analysis examinations, concentrating on keeping total wellness. Together, these components develop a complete security web for seniors, dealing with various health care needs. Recognizing the specifics of what these components cover is important for senior citizens to maximize their benefits and lessen out-of-pocket expenditures. Correct application of Medicare Components A and B can greatly enhance the quality of care gotten throughout important medical situations.

Preventive Care Options
Although several elders may be unaware, preventive care options play an important role in keeping their health and health. Medicare Parts A and B provide different preventive services created to capture health problems early and boost general lifestyle. These services include yearly wellness gos to, screenings for problems such as cancer cells, diabetes mellitus, and heart illness, along with vaccinations for flu and pneumonia. Furthermore, Medicare covers counseling for smoking cessation and weight problems, encouraging healthier way of living options. By making use of these preventive care alternatives, senior citizens can considerably decrease the danger of chronic health problems and prevent costly therapies down the line. Understanding and accessing these solutions can empower seniors to take cost of their health proactively, causing better results and improved long life.
Medicare Advantage Strategies: An Alternate Alternative
As lots of elderly people discover their medical care alternatives, Medicare Advantage Strategies have actually arised as a viable alternative to standard Medicare. These plans, commonly provided by exclusive insurance firms, combine the benefits of Medicare Component A and Component B, and often include added services such as vision, dental, and health care. One of the essential appeals of Medicare Advantage is the possibility for reduced out-of-pocket expenses compared to traditional Medicare, specifically for those who call for constant clinical care.Furthermore, numerous Medicare Benefit Plans supply a worked with approach to medical care, with a focus on preventive services and persistent condition management. This can cause improved health and wellness outcomes for elders. Senior citizens should, however, very carefully review the network of suppliers and plan specifics, as these can vary significantly among various Advantage Strategies. Inevitably, Medicare Benefit serves as an adaptable alternative, satisfying the varied needs of the senior populace.

Supplemental Insurance: Medigap Plans Explained
Supplemental insurance, frequently referred to as Medigap, works as a crucial resource for senior citizens seeking to cover the voids left by Medicare. These strategies are designed to function together with Original Medicare (Components A and B), supplying extra coverage for prices such as copayments, coinsurance, and deductibles. Medigap policies usually can be found in standard plans, classified A via N, each supplying different degrees of benefits.Seniors can acquire these strategies from private insurance policy business, and premiums might vary based upon aspects such as location and age. Notably, Medigap does not cover services like long-term treatment, vision, or dental. Enrollment in a Medigap strategy can occur throughout a six-month open registration period, which starts when a private turns 65 and enrolls in Medicare Component B. Comprehending Medigap strategies is essential for elders to guarantee they have sufficient protection and financial defense against unanticipated healthcare expenditures.

Financial Help Programs for Seniors
As seniors navigate the complexities of healthcare and living expenses, monetary assistance programs function as important resources to assist minimize several of their problems. Different federal and state campaigns supply assistance, including Supplemental Safety Revenue (SSI) and Supplemental Nutrition Support Program (BREEZE), which supply financial aid and food assistance respectively. Low-Income Home Energy Support Program (LIHEAP) helps seniors with cooling look at this site and heating prices, guaranteeing they continue to be comfy and safe in their homes.Additionally, many seniors might get Medicaid, which covers clinical costs for those with restricted income. Not-for-profit companies frequently offer programs or grants particularly customized to help senior citizens with medical care, transport, and housing requirements. By exploring these choices, seniors can locate essential assistance to enhance their lifestyle, permitting them to handle costs more efficiently and focus on their health and wellness and health. Understanding of these resources can greatly impact senior citizens' economic stability.

How Do I Enroll in Medicare for the Very First Time?
To sign up in Medicare for the very first time, people normally need to see the main Medicare website, phone call Medicare straight, or apply via Social Safety and security, guaranteeing they satisfy qualification requirements and target dates for registration.
What Is the Price of Medicare Premiums and Deductibles?
The expense of Medicare deductibles and premiums differs based upon the particular strategy selected. Normally, costs can range from $0 to several hundred dollars monthly, while deductibles depend upon the insurance coverage type and service made use of.
Can I Utilize My Medicare Protection Outside the U.S.?
Medicare coverage primarily works within the USA. While some minimal services could be covered abroad, many recipients locate that Medicare does not prolong to international health care, requiring additional travel insurance policy for abroad clinical requirements.
What Occurs if I Miss the Registration Deadline?
If an individual misses the enrollment deadline, they may face a delay in coverage, incur charges, or need to wait up until the next registration duration. This can bring about increased medical care prices and limited alternatives.
Exist Charges for Late Registration in Medicare?
The penalties for late enrollment in Medicare can lead to increased costs. Particularly, a 10% surcharge is added for each year the individual hold-ups registration, stressing the value of prompt registration to avoid additional prices.
